The FRAT has 3 areas: drop risk status, risk factor list, and action plan. A Loss Danger Standing consists of information concerning background of recent falls, drugs, emotional and cognitive condition of the individual - Dementia Fall Risk.


If the person scores on a risk variable, the equivalent number of points are counted to the person's loss danger rating in package to the much appropriate. If a client's loss danger score totals 5 or higher, the person is at high threat for drops. If the client ratings just four points or lower, they are still at some danger of falling, and the nurse must utilize their finest medical evaluation to take care of all fall threat factors as component of an all natural care plan.

Fall Risk-Increasing Medicines (FRID) describes the medicines well-recorded to be related to heightened loss danger. These make up however are not limited to anti-hypertensives, anti-psychotics, narcotics, sedatives, and anticholinergics. As an example, current official source researches have actually revealed that long-lasting use proton pump preventions (PPIs) boosted the danger of falls (Lapumnuaypol et al., 2019).


Raised physical conditioning minimizes the danger for drops and restricts injury that is suffered when fall takes place. Land and water-based workout programs might be similarly valuable on equilibrium and stride and thus minimize the threat for falls. Water exercise may add a positive advantage on equilibrium and read gait for females 65 years and older.


Chair Rise Exercise is a basic sit-to-stand exercise that assists enhance the muscles in the upper legs and buttocks and boosts movement and independence. The goal is to do Chair Increase exercises without using hands as the customer ends up being more powerful. See resources area for an in-depth direction on how to execute Chair Surge exercise.
